Configuring a static LSP
The principle of establishing a static LSP is that the outgoing label of an upstream LSR is the incoming
label of its downstream LSR.
Before you configure a static LSP, complete the following tasks:
Determine the ingress LSR, transit LSRs, and egress LSR for the static LSP.
Enable MPLS on all these LSRs.
Make sure the ingress LSR has a route to the FEC destination. This is not required on the transit LSRs
and egress LSR.
When you configure a static LSP, follow these configuration restrictions and guidelines:
The outgoing label of an upstream LSR is the incoming label of its downstream LSR.
When you configure a static LSP on the ingress LSR, the next hop specified must be consistent with
the next hop of the optimal route in the routing table. If you configure a static IP route for the LSP, be
sure to specify the same next hop for the static route and the static LSP. For information about
configuring a static IP route, see Layer 3—IP Routing Configuration Guide.
For an ingress or transit LSR, do not specify the public address of an interface on the LSR as the next
hop address.
To configure a static LSP:

1. Enter system view.
system-view N/A
2. Configure a static LSP..
On the ingress node:
static-lsp ingress lsp-name destination
dest-addr { mask | mask-length } nexthop
next-hop-addr out-label out-label
On a transit node:
static-lsp transit lsp-name
incoming-interface interface-type
interface-number in-label in-label
nexthop next-hop-addr out-label out-label
On the egress node:
static-lsp egress lsp-name
incoming-interface interface-type
interface-number in-label in-label
Follow the configuration
guidelines to set correct
parameters for the ingress,
transit, and egress nodes.
